| @@ -130,7 +130,16 @@ function parseFile(fileParam: string | null): string | undefined { |
| return undefined |
| } |
| |
| - return devirtualizeReactServerURL(fileParam) |
| + const file = devirtualizeReactServerURL(fileParam) |
| + // React virtualizes filenames as `'file://' + path`, which is malformed |
| + // for paths that need percent-encoding (e.g. a space in the project path) |
| + // and then fails both Turbopack's `traceSource` and Node.js' source map |
| + // cache lookups. Re-encode through WHATWG URL parsing. |
| + // TODO(veil): Revisit if React's virtualization round-trips losslessly. |
| + if (file.startsWith('file://') && URL.canParse(file)) { |
| + return new URL(file).href |
| + } |
| + return file |
| } |
